Output 177600fc186fcd7f71630d4e93f0d12d88d0a5f4619ffaf03be6fe8462695d8c:201

value
115711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e457caa5cbee2ea15a8e947d568941ab54293b OP_EQUAL
address
3HBKfWSb99rVyvoojrvQQLrqLk3iwkbLQn
transaction
177600fc186fcd7f71630d4e93f0d12d88d0a5f4619ffaf03be6fe8462695d8c
spent
true